Drinking Mates


Clarrie and Mike were drinking mates
they spent their life at the " Western Star "
each and every day would find them
perched up at the public bar.

And drink ! these two could swill them
beer pots disappeared with glee.
Followed up with rum or stout for chasers
after every two or three.

They were what you might call regulars
to all who came from near and far.
Plaques with their names were fastened
to their spots up at the bar.

They had been sitting at the bar one day
since the doors had opened wide,
and now it was close to three p.m.
though time was on their side.

With twenty pots or more consumed
plus a rum or stout or two.
Clarrie made a movement
to stumble to the loo

As he climbed down from the bar stool
his face was looking poor.
He fell in a drunken stupor
and lay unconscious on the floor

Mike turned and looked at Clarrie
and in a voice both slurred and gruff.
That's what I like with Clarrie
he knows when he's had enough.

Bob Pacey (C)
